Other areas, such Illinois’ McHenry County, has also experimented with treated salt and manufacturing its own brine. “The drivers here are environmental concerns, cost and performance,” Wood points out. The Vermont Agency of Transportation's Materials and Research Section conducted a study on the use of salt brine and salt brine mixtures.
The primary objectives of the research initiative, "Salt Brine, Salt Brine Blends And Application Technologies During the 2008-2009 Winter Maintenance Season" were to construct a salt brine facility, experiment with different combinations of salt brine and other ice melting additives, reduce the use of winter road sand while raising the level of service of state roads, and to determine if costs savings can be attributed to the use of salt brine and/or salt brine combinations.,The Vermont Agency of Transportation's Materials and Research Section conducted a study on the use of salt brine and salt brine mixtures.
